  3. I would recommend Teflon valve stem seals , SSI has them or Chris Wilson I would leave the head gasket in situ unless you have issue , opening the block can cause more issues than its worth You can do the Valve stem seals in Situ , Colin did mine in SSI ; he made himself a nice tool to do it
